This is a photo of the worshipping place in my friend’s house. We Nepali Hindu’s usually put pictures of our gods and goddesses in a separate room or area and worship them in the morning and evening.

Here the women are working to create a new mushroom farm at the shelter. When the mushrooms are harvested, they will be sold at local markets to generate an income for the shelter, as well as being eaten by the women and children
